Tofu Plasters

These treatments are cooling. Thus, they are used to remove heat from the body. They can be used for moderate to high fevers. Put the plaster on the forehead or on the nape of the neck to help relieve a fever. For a headache, use the plaster over the aching area.

Tofu Plaster #1:

  • 60% tofu
  • 40% wheat flour

Put the tofu in a clean cloth and gently squeeze out the water. Next, place the squeezed tofu in a bowl and add the flour. Mix thoroughly. Put the mixture on a clean cloth, spreading it evenly to a depth of about 1/4 inch thick. Bandage the plaster in place. Change the plaster every two hours, when the plaster is halfway dry, or when it turns yellow - whichever comes first. You can turn the plaster over and use the other side. Then, discard the original plaster and repeat the process with a freshly made plaster. Check the user's temperature regularly to make sure their temperature does not drop too low!

Tofu Plaster #2:

  • 75% tofu
  • 20% wheat flour
  • 5% fresh grated ginger root

Proceed as instructed above.
